#c6b864 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c6b864 is composed of 77.6% red, 72.2%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.1% magenta, 49.5%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 51.4 degrees, a saturation of 46.2% and a lightness of 58.4%. #c6b864 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c8 with #8d7100.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

● #c6b864 color description : Slightly desaturated yellow.
#c6b864 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c6b864 has RGB values of R:198, G:184,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.07, Y:0.49,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13023332.

Shades and Tints of #c6b864
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030301 is the darkest color, while #fbfaf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c6b864
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#959595 is the less saturated color, while #f7db33 is the most saturated one.
